Okay so here's the deal. The sheriff sent Shalelu off to do some specific goblin scouting after the attack on Sandpoint with a mind to come back and give info to the players about the current state of goblin affairs. Off she went.

And then I promptly forgot about her and so did the players. Until finally after the first chapter but before the second they had plenty of downtime and one player thought about asking Shalelu something when they realized nobody had heard from her in days.

Thistletop is dealt with and the goblin threat is neutralized and I actually ended the session with a cliffhanger of the Sheriff coming up to them to tell them of the murders so they'll get caught up in that pretty quick I think.

Now I could just chalk it up as her going around to check on all the tribes and just coming back too late to be useful, but it might be fun to have had something happen to her. Captured by one of the later villains or caught up in having found something and followed a trail or whatnot. I have only really skimmed the chapters past the second one.

So does anyone have any nifty situations I could put Shelalu in that the players could find out about down the road and would explain her absence since she was specifically supposed to come back and report to the town and never did.

So. The PCs.

Echves (pronounced eck-ves with the e as in egg, not eek) - Human Male Fighter from Riddleport. (Female Player). (NG) Echves is going 2 handed weapon style. He's not very talkative unless you can get him in front of the ladies or on a hunt. Otherwise he's the "point me at the enemy" kind of guy.

Merlinwen - Elven Female Rogue from Sandpoint. (Female Player). (CN) Merlinwen is orginally from Sandport but went to work in Korvosa for a while. She's a "security expert". She's playing the elf as more of the respected person who gets hired to make sure things get run correctly and security is tight. Merlinwen currently works for the Sandpoint Mercantile League for the NPC Sir Jasper. Her main work is making sure shipments coming in and outgoing are legit and people aren't trying to cheat the League. She also carries important messages that have to get to various places in Varisia or sometimes guards caravans. Well respected in town by everyone except maybe the Scarnettis whom she helps keep in line. No love lost there as Sir Jasper is not only a good boss but a friend.

Dorviksun - Dwarven Male Cleric of Caiden from Janderhoff. (Male Player). (CG) Dorviksun is a wanderer at heart. He travels at whim and divine guidance. He's good natured and kind and ready to share a pint of beer, a joke, his healing powers, or whatever else is needed of him. He has a high strength and fairly proud of it and wields a warhammer with great effect.

Lysandra - Half-Elf Female Ranger from Magnamar. (Male Player). (CG) Lysandra has a high charisma and he plays her off as the kind, outgoing type. She's going to be the one to make all the Diplomacy checks of the party as he even threw his free Half-Elf skill feat into that and took the Magnimar city campaign feat for several more points.
